If corals just gain that junk from zooxanthellae anyways why is there not more posts about people adding it to their coral food? I've been using both brown and white sugar and glycerine for about a month now and don't really see any adverse effects other than most the nuisance algae in my tank is completely gone. My corals are all firing off a couple of heads a week now. I'm not ADVISING it and if someone tries it and jacks their tank up it's not my fault but for me, it seems to work. I started doing it just for giggles a month ago and I kinda like the results.
